Amia is a first name for girls.

Amia is a common name for girls!

The name Amia isn’t among the current fashionable names in our top 10 stats, but nonetheless, it’s still very popular and common. In our SmartGenius ranking of all girls names, Amia ranks 888. Recently, out of every 10,000 newborn girls, approximately 2 were named Amia. If you polled the whole US population – children, adults and seniors – you’d find less than one in 10,000 to be named Amia.

What does the name 
Amia mean?

A modern form of a medieval name: Amia is a variant of Amy, that was already popular in 16th-century England. Via French Amee, it developed from the Latin name Amata, which was inspired by the word ‘amata’ meaning ‘beloved’.

Amia was created in... the early 1970s, when Amy was one of the most popular girls names in the US.

Well, you might say, you probably figured that out yourself! But what you might not know is: The letter A is the most popular first letter for girls’ names. 11.8% of all common girls’ names in the US start with this letter. The second most common first letter in girls' names is S.

With four letters, the name Amia is shorter than most other given names. In fact, only 5.5% of all common first names in the US consist of exactly four letters. Just 1.2% of all first names are even shorter, while 93% consist of more than four letters. On average, first names in the US (not counting hyphenated names) are 6.5 letters long. There are no significant differences between boys' and girls' names.

That means that if 11.8% of all girls' names start with an A, this initial letter occurs over three times as often as all other letters on average. And, by the way, of all the girls' names that begin with the letter A, the name Ashley is the most common.
